Peripheral Giant Cell Lesion (LPCG) is a non-neoplastic proliferative process.
reactive to local irritation as low intensity and long duration traumas. The objective
of this work is to report a case of (LPCG) in a 44-year-old feoderma patient who
attended the School Clinic of Dentistry of the Federal University of Campina
Grande (UFCG), reporting an uncomfortable oral cavity. The radiographic
examination revealed a modest radiopaque area, suggesting the presence of
bone material. The correct diagnosis and the appropriate treatment culminated in
satisfactory results and complete resolution of the case, with no evidence of
relapses.
